Output 6dacb5625bbca13430f81731c4ba904033363cd4cb33a56c99d8ed0a55728d85:0

value
1904648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7945342b3afa8d19a5ef47fff5c3494fdfb144f9 OP_EQUALVERIFY OP_CHECKSIG
address
1C4DfaLQWkUpoSR4yjFWDPfLGV8xqC5ej7
transaction
6dacb5625bbca13430f81731c4ba904033363cd4cb33a56c99d8ed0a55728d85
spent
true